The most immediate and tangible benefit of the Bangle is the raw survivability it provides. In a game where the margin between victory and a trip back to the Fragmented Shores is often a single mis-timed parry, the additional health points (HP) are a direct extension of the player’s margin for error. However, Deepwoken distinguishes itself from other RPGs through its Posture system. Posture is the invisible stamina of defense; when broken, a player is stunned, leaving them helpless against a devastating critical hit. The Sovereign’s Bangle’s bonus to Posture is, therefore, arguably more valuable than its HP increase. It allows a player to weather a furious flurry of blows from a sharko or a corrupted owl, holding their ground where others would crumple. This isn't just a numerical advantage; it is a psychological weapon. Knowing you have a larger posture pool allows you to play more aggressively, to block that extra hit, and to wait for the perfect moment to parry and riposte.

Beyond the numbers lies the Bangle’s true genius: the unique talent it grants, Sovereign’s Poise . This talent rewards the ultimate display of skill in Deepwoken —the perfect parry (or “parry trade”). In standard play, a parry stops an enemy’s attack and opens them for a brief moment. With Sovereign’s Poise , a successful parry grants a short burst of hyper-armor and damage reduction. This transforms the player from a reactive defender into an unstoppable force of momentum. Instead of parrying an attack to simply reset the neutral game, the wearer of the Bangle can parry and then immediately launch a heavy, slow-moving mantras or a charged attack without fear of being staggered out of the animation. The Bangle does not hand the player victory; it rewards the player for mastering the game’s core defensive mechanic. It encourages a high-risk, high-reward playstyle where the player steps into danger, confident that their timing will turn an enemy’s aggression into their own opening. deepwoken sovereign bangle

In the unforgiving, sunken world of Deepwoken , where permadeath lurks behind every shadow and a single mistake can erase hours of progress, the value of an item is not measured in gold alone, but in survival. Among the pantheon of relics, artifacts, and armaments that players risk their lives to obtain, the Sovereign’s Bangle stands out not for its offensive power, but for its profound strategic elegance. At first glance, a simple wrist accessory that boosts health and posture seems modest. However, to dismiss the Sovereign’s Bangle as mere stat-stick is to misunderstand the very core of Deepwoken’s brutal combat philosophy. The Sovereign’s Bangle is a masterclass in subtle, defensive empowerment—a silent guardian that transforms a glass cannon into a resilient duelist and a panicked survivor into a composed counter-attacker. Of course, no item exists in a vacuum. The Sovereign’s Bangle is not a flashy, game-breaking legendary that wins fights on its own. It demands competence. A player who cannot parry will find the Bangle a useless hunk of metal. Its power is entirely derivative of the wearer’s skill. In this way, it is the most honest and rewarding item in Deepwoken . It doesn’t offer a “get out of jail free” card like a teleportation mantra or an instant-kill spell. It offers a foundation upon which mastery is built.
